Semester-Long Rebranding Project
project introduction
For this project, we were assigned to conduct a rebrand for a brand or company based on certain guidelines given to us from the results of a random generator. The restrictions I was given were:
Brand Type: Cultural Institution
Core Challenge: Unify multiple departments under one brand system
Primary Audience: First-time users unfamiliar with the service
Brand Personality Constraint: Must function effectively in multilingual contexts
With these results, I chose my client: The Columbus Zoo and Aquarium. It fits within these constraints because it qualifies as a cultural institution, as it brings communities and families together. The brand also includes four total activity locations, including the zoo, aquarium, amusement park, and safari adventure that feel separated and distant. Finally, a zoo is also a great place to target first-time visitors and to include multilingual contexts, especially in such a big city like Columbus.
